Jin-ah, the former leader of once popular girl band "Purple," hosts a radio show called "Wonderful Radio." When the producer of the program is sacked over low ratings, a new guy comes in to fill his shoes. Jae-hyeok is a cold, unfriendly man who only drinks iced coffee even in the winter. The easily irritable man and the conceited former diva are bound to get on each other's nerves at every corner. (imdb)

A detective, who moonlights as a private investigator, has a beautiful new client. The woman asks the detective to take photos of her husband in the midst of having an affair with another woman. When the detective goes to take pictures he discovers that the woman's husband is already dead. He must now set out for the real killer. (imdb)
Seung-Joo is a CEO and Jung-Taek is a detective. They have known each other for 20 years.
One night, Seung-Joo loses his cellphone to four male high-school students and Jung-Taek loses his gun to the same high-school students. The cellphone and gun are very valuable to Seung-Joo and Jung-Taek. The two men must get their items back from the high school students.

Strange Fairy Tale (2015) - TV Special
Sang-goo abandons his children to fight for the rights he has been ridden of and Soo-bong, the eldest son, acts as the actual breadwinner of the family with various part-time jobs. The boy takes care of the family's daily routine instead of his father who is a story illustrator. He struggles with daily life that is nothing alike the fairytales he's read but realizes the values of family and the true meaning of happiness.
